This trade will be especially important to Californians. because our productivity. reserves. and geographical location will insure that a large percentage of this trade will be with California firms. The administration has submitted the trade agreement to Congress together with a Presidential waiver of restrictions in section 402 of the 1974 Trade Act which would prohibit extension of credits and investment guarantees to the PRC. The terms of this Presidential waiver are fully consistent with the provisions of the socalled JacksonVanik amendment. which places curbs on trade with Communist countries denying emigration rights to their citizens. I support the Presidents determination that the PRC should now be made eligible for trade credits and investment guarantees. I am concerned. however. that not enough effort has been made to insure that sufficient ExportImport Bank credits will be available for full implementation of the trade agreement.
